Solution
1. Preparation
  • Ensure the vehicle is parked on a flat surface.
  • Disconnect the 12V battery to prevent electrical shock.
  • Gather tools including an OBD-II scanner, multimeter, and basic hand tools.
2. Battery Terminal Inspection
  • Remove the covers from the battery terminals.
  • Clean any corrosion using a wire brush and a mixture of baking soda and water.
  • Tighten any loose connections securely.
3. Fuses Inspection and Replacement
  • Locate the fuse box per the vehicle's manual.
  • Identify and pull fuses related to malfunctioning components.
  • Inspect each fuse for continuity with a multimeter.
  • Replace any blown fuses with the correct amperage rating.
4. 12V Battery Check
  • Reconnect the 12V battery and measure its voltage using a multimeter.
  • If the voltage is below 12.4V, charge the battery or replace it if it's faulty.
  • Check the voltage during vehicle operation to ensure proper charging.
5. Wiring Inspection
  • Visually inspect wiring harnesses for fraying or exposed wires.
  • Use a multimeter to test continuity in critical wires.
  • Repair or replace damaged wiring as necessary.
